i am a canberra based counsellor who believes that feeling heard and understood is the foundation for change. i offer a warm, authentic, and compassionate space where you can be yourself without judgement. my approach is grounded in empathy and positive regard, and i work alongside each person in a way that respects their unique story and strengths.
i’m the parent of three adult children and know that life brings both challenges and unexpected opportunities. outside of work, i enjoy hiking, cycling, rowing, and spending time outdoors to help me stay grounded and connected. i am also proud to have volunteered with red cross and lifeline.

areas of support
I work across a broad range of life challenges, offering specialised support for individuals, couples, and families.
-
managing anxiety, depression, low self-esteem, loneliness, burnout, and finding meaning, identity, and purpose.
-
navigating relationship conflicts, communication challenges, boundaries, couples counselling, and structural family shifts.
-
support for major life changes; settlement support, career shifts, retirement, empty nesters.
-
understanding and navigating personal loss, grief, and bereavement.
-
alcohol, drug, and gambling harm minimisation and recovery. support for family members and loved ones impacted by addiction
